The cheapest way to get from Gymea to Bargo is to bus which costs $12 - $21 and takes 4h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Gymea to Bargo is to drive which takes 1h and costs $15 - $22.
No, there is no direct bus from Gymea to Bargo station. However, there are services departing from Kingsway Before Gymea Bay Rd and arriving at Bargo Station, Railside Av via East Hills Station, Park Rd and Campbelltown Station, Farrow Rd, Stand G.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 16m.
The distance between Gymea and Bargo is 123 km. The road distance is 84.5 km.
The best way to get from Gymea to Bargo without a car is to bus and train which takes 2h 45m and costs $14 - $23.
It takes approximately 2h 45m to get from Gymea to Bargo, including transfers.
Gymea to Bargo bus services, operated by Transport for NSW, depart from Kingsway Before Gymea Bay Rd station.
Gymea to Bargo bus services, operated by Transport for NSW, arrive at East Hills Station, Park Rd.
Yes, the driving distance between Gymea to Bargo is 84 km. It takes approximately 1h to drive from Gymea to Bargo.
